Another one bites the dust ..
Craig Brewster, sacked yesterday as manager of Inverness Caley, was in his second managerial spell at the club having re-joined Caley following spells as manager of home-town team Dundee United and as a player with Aberdeen. Inverness, who finished 9th in the table last season are one of only four clubs in the SPL never to have been relegated, but the teams performances this season has made many in the stands wonder if this is the year that that statistic will change .
